Lousy TF-33?
The TF33/JT3D is one of the best selling engines of all time.
The only mechanical issues these fleets have are due to the fact that they haven't had full overhauls in decades.
Now, if you care about fuel burn, yes, a 1960s engine would be poor relative to any engine built today. But the B-52 flies infrequently and has very very large fuel tanks. You will never save enough fuel to justify a re-engine. But a JT3D can be reairfoiled during a full overhaul for a dramatic fuel burn improvment. You can easily put a FADEC on it too. The potential of that core was never realized.
